Cyclone Boris Batters Central Europe: Floods Loom
Central Europe is bracing for a deluge as Cyclone Boris barrels towards the region, threatening…
14 September 2024
Central Europe is bracing for a deluge as Cyclone Boris barrels towards the region, threatening…
Central Europe is on high alert as weather models predict a significant rainfall event in…